Output 8362133e6395b5afd67b404649bd2b1015f1981de1fa35362c0b115fd47d1aef:5

value
445873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9573c24f054562429c379011b0f0f9cc666f47 OP_EQUAL
address
3PXpTWbE8hVfTUNbgfj8btAA61kqQTycgH
transaction
8362133e6395b5afd67b404649bd2b1015f1981de1fa35362c0b115fd47d1aef
spent
true